Meaning of dead on arrival in English:

dead on arrival

Translate dead on arrival into Spanish


  • 1Used to describe a person who is declared dead immediately upon arrival at a hospital.

    1. 1.1(of an idea, etc.) declared ineffective without ever having been put into effect.
      • ‘why are people pronouncing the plan dead on arrival in the legislature?’